titleOfInvention System and method for identifying working fluids
abstract Systems and methods are provided for identifying working fluids. The system and method include exposing at least a portion of a working fluid comprising a UV reactive chemical marker to light having a wavelength in the range of from about 10 to 400 nm, thereby causing the chemical marker to generate a signal. The signal can be detected by a sensor system and compared with a reference signal derived from a real working fluid. An output can be generated to indicate whether the working fluid is a real working fluid.
